Florida Fundamentos de Programación Informática Honores
- Level High School
- Contact Hours 170
- Timeframe Year
El curso con honores de Fundamentos de Programación Informática de Florida ofrece una introducción a los conceptos esenciales de la informática a través de la programación. Los estudiantes explorarán temas clave como las técnicas de resolución de problemas, la organización de estructuras de datos para la gestión de grandes conjuntos de datos y el desarrollo e implementación de algoritmos para el procesamiento de datos y el descubrimiento de información.
To view the entire syllabus, click here or click to explore the full course.
La ciberseguridad y tú
Los estudiantes profundizan en áreas clave como la recopilación de datos personales, la fiabilidad de la información en línea, la ética y las leyes cibernéticas, la seguridad de los datos personales, los aspectos esenciales de la ciberseguridad y las estrategias para combatir las ciberamenazas comunes y su prevención, equipando a las personas con los conocimientos necesarios para navegar por el panorama digital de forma responsable y segura. |
Conceptos de IT
Los alumnos exploran la estructura y el diseño de Internet y las redes, y cómo afecta este diseño a la fiabilidad de la comunicación en red, la seguridad de los datos y la privacidad personal. Los alumnos aprenderán cómo Internet conecta ordenadores de todo el mundo mediante el uso de protocolos de red. |
Infraestructura informática
Los alumnos aprenden sobre los elementos físicos de los ordenadores y las redes, como las placas base, la RAM, los routers y el uso de números de puerto, ethernet y dispositivos inalámbricos. |
Interacción básica con Python y la consola
Los alumnos aprenden los fundamentos de la programación escribiendo programas que interactúan con los usuarios a través del teclado. |
Condicionales
Los alumnos enseñan a sus programas a tomar decisiones basándose en la información que recibe. |
Loops
Los alumnos aprenden a escribir código más eficaz utilizando bucles como atajos. |
Proyecto: Autentificador de contraseñas
Los alumnos escriben un programa para proporcionar información sobre si la contraseña introducida es correcta o incorrecta. |
Funciones y excepciones
Los alumnos aprenden cómo sus programas pueden descomponerse en piezas más pequeñas que funcionan juntas para resolver un problema. |
Crear y modificar estructuras de datos
Los alumnos aprenden cómo se forman las tuplas y las listas y los distintos métodos que pueden alterarlas. |
Clases y objetos
Los alumnos aprenden sobre las clases y los principios del diseño orientado a objetos. |
Funciones en un equipo de desarrollo de software
Los alumnos aprenden las funciones y responsabilidades clave de los miembros de un equipo de desarrollo de software. |
Crear páginas web
En este módulo, los alumnos aprenden los conceptos básicos de HTML y CSS mientras construyen páginas web sencillas. |
El ciclo de vida de la ciencia de datos
Los alumnos aprenderán y aplicarán el proceso del ciclo de vida de la ciencia de datos. Esto incluye formular preguntas estadísticas, recoger u obtener datos brutos fiables, analizar los datos utilizando medidas de tendencia central y dispersión e interpretar y resumir los resultados. |
Introducción a la IA
En este módulo, los alumnos comprenderán los principales conceptos y vocabulario en torno a la IA. |
Proyecto: Proceso de diseño de ingeniería
En este proyecto, los alumnos aprenderán la teoría y la práctica del proceso de diseño de ingeniería. Este proyecto permite a los alumnos pensar de forma creativa sobre las aplicaciones de los conceptos tratados en el curso, y crear algo de valor personal. |
Explore programs that your students will build throughout this course!
Here are a few examples of teacher resources and materials to use in the Florida Fundamentos de Programación Informática Honores course
Florida Fundamentos de Programación Informática Honores is aligned with the following standards
Standards Framework | View Alignment |
---|---|
Florida Computer Programming Fundamentals Honors | View (100%) |
Create and organize Assignments in any CodeHS course that you're teaching. You can even add custom assignments to pre-existing CodeHS courses.
Learn MoreDidn't find what you were looking for? Here are a few links that might be useful to you.